#b26ccf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b26ccf is composed of 69.8% red, 42.4%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14% cyan, 47.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 282.4 degrees, a saturation of 50.8% and a lightness of 61.8%. #b26ccf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d8ff with #65009f.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

Shades and Tints of #b26ccf
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#f8f1f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#b26ccf
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9f99a2 is the less saturated color, while #c53ffc is the most saturated one.
